摘 要 在計算機技術(shù)的不斷發(fā)展過程中,計算機課程作為高校的必修課程,而高校機房對于教學(xué)的質(zhì)量有著關(guān)鍵的影響,因此必須要對高校機房管理系統(tǒng)進行系統(tǒng)的研究分析,這樣才可以充分的凸顯高校機房自身的價值與效應(yīng),對此文章主要對高校機房管理系統(tǒng)的開發(fā)與研究進行了簡單的探究分析。
【關(guān)鍵詞】高校機房 開放式機房 集約管理模式 開發(fā)與設(shè)計
高校機房作為重要的教學(xué)設(shè)施,直接關(guān)系到教學(xué)質(zhì)量與效果,對此在實踐中要想保障各項任務(wù)的穩(wěn)定開展,必須要對高校機房管理系統(tǒng)起到足夠的重視,對此文章主要對高校機房的管理系統(tǒng)進行了簡單的探究分析。
1 高校機房的傳統(tǒng)職能與發(fā)展
高校機房傳統(tǒng)管理方式就是在機房管理中,通過專業(yè)的教師與人員對其機房設(shè)備和上機人員進行管理、網(wǎng)絡(luò)軟件的安裝和機房的安全監(jiān)督及清潔等,對機房設(shè)備進行日常的維護與處理,進而保障教學(xué)的正常開展。傳統(tǒng)的機房管理模式,就是對整個設(shè)備進行系統(tǒng)的統(tǒng)籌、對機房故障對其進行及時分析與排除,進而提升其整體的工作效率。傳統(tǒng)的機房管理模式任務(wù)較為繁雜,種類也較為繁瑣,具有一定的重復(fù)性,整體管理水平相對較低。從整體上來說,高校機房的傳統(tǒng)管理模式已經(jīng)不能適應(yīng)當(dāng)前高校教學(xué)不斷增長的專業(yè)需求,阻礙其發(fā)展的弊端主要表現(xiàn)如下:
1.1 資源配置缺乏合理性
在現(xiàn)階段的高校機房管理模式中,合理高效的資源配置是一個突出問題,這也是一項較為顯著的問題。多數(shù)的高校機房都是通過分批投放的方式對其進行資源配置,此種方式投入的周期相對較長,資源配置具有一定的差異性,直接降低了高校機房的使用效果,高校機房的硬件、軟件等配置也無法滿足日益增長的實際的教學(xué)需求,同時一些學(xué)校在機房的聯(lián)網(wǎng)過程中,多是通過局域網(wǎng)進行連接,也極大地降低了機房的有效應(yīng)用范圍。
1.2 應(yīng)用環(huán)境相對較為復(fù)雜
在現(xiàn)階段的高校機房中開展的課程主要是專業(yè)基礎(chǔ)課程與專業(yè)知識的教學(xué),但是在對計算機的管理設(shè)置過程中無法對其進行系統(tǒng)的分工,直接導(dǎo)致了學(xué)生無法進行系統(tǒng)的知識學(xué)習(xí)。在整體上來說高校機房的環(huán)境具有一定的復(fù)雜性,系統(tǒng)具有一定的差異,在不同的操作系統(tǒng)以及應(yīng)用軟件中具有較為顯著的差異,直接增加了學(xué)生的操作難度。
1.3 計算機的監(jiān)管與維護相對困難
傳統(tǒng)的機房管理模式中,計算機維護效果相對較差,直接影響了計算機的正常應(yīng)用。雖然在整體上來說是通過專業(yè)的教師對其進行維護,但是覆蓋面積相對較小。教師無法及時制止學(xué)生各種違規(guī)操作方式,一些人為的破壞方式也直接的計算影響了維護工作的開展,此種方式在實踐中會直接的降低計算機的維護效益,降低學(xué)習(xí)效果。
2 現(xiàn)代機房的基本作用
在信息時代,開放式的機房是今后發(fā)展的必然趨勢,對教學(xué)活動的開展以及高校的發(fā)展有著直接的影響。
2.1 高校開放式機房概述
可以從管理角度以及技術(shù)角度對開放式機房進行詮釋。從管理角度來說,開放式機房就是無需管理員現(xiàn)場管理,學(xué)生自主上機操作的一種管理模式,同時,其并不受到開放時間的限制,學(xué)生可以利用課余時間進行自由的學(xué)習(xí)。而在技術(shù)角度來講。開放式機房管理就是可以通過擴充方式開展的公用集約化的管理模式,在實踐中利用校園網(wǎng)絡(luò)或者局域網(wǎng),通過低配置的微機作前臺工作,利用高性能的PC機構(gòu)建后臺數(shù)據(jù)庫,進而實現(xiàn)對各個機房電腦高效率的系統(tǒng)管理。
開放式機房在實踐中有著較為顯著的優(yōu)勢,可以提升學(xué)生的積極性,提升學(xué)習(xí)的效果與質(zhì)量;同時也可以承接國家級和省市的各類考試 如全國四六級英語口語考試、全國計算機等級考試等;省級行業(yè)考試如郵電系統(tǒng)業(yè)務(wù)考試等;學(xué)校的普通話測試、計算機專業(yè)考試等。
2.2 開放式機房的管理重點
但是不可否認(rèn)的是,開放式機房在實踐中還是存在一定的管理問題,對此在實踐中要想提升開放式機房的有效性,就必須全面分析開放式機房的工作特點,抓住重點要,解決困難和問題。
(1)解決機房設(shè)施缺乏安全性的問題。安全性是開放式機房面臨的首要問題,在實踐中學(xué)??梢酝ㄟ^“一卡通”的數(shù)字化方式,提升開放式機房的安全性,通過門禁系統(tǒng),確認(rèn)學(xué)員的身份,進行自主識別繳費屬性,以加強對進入機房人員的控制。同時校園卡也可以對學(xué)生的上機時間、機號等進行記錄,通過系統(tǒng)設(shè)置的方式限制計算機的應(yīng)用,進而避免濫用計算機的問題出現(xiàn)。
(2)可以通過互聯(lián)網(wǎng)絡(luò)技術(shù)對其開放式機房進行系統(tǒng)的管理,將機房分為中心機房以及公共機房兩個部分內(nèi)容,對其進行合理的配置,設(shè)置服務(wù)器以及防火墻等相關(guān)設(shè)備。同時通過互聯(lián)網(wǎng)絡(luò)技術(shù)、云桌面技術(shù),進行資源的獲取,通過服務(wù)器接口與云計算中心的交互,就可以完成用戶信息的注冊與登陸,進而保障用戶信息資源的安全性。錄到云計算機中心之后,云計算中心就會基于用戶的具體操作對其進行系統(tǒng)的判斷分析,基于其操作的不同方式進行云計算中心的處理;在用戶申請不同的軟件、硬件以及相關(guān)存儲信息服務(wù)的時候,使用用戶可以基于自身的實際需求申請對應(yīng)的服務(wù)、應(yīng)用以及資源獲取;可以基于用戶的基本需求對其進行資源以及計算機能力的優(yōu)化與完善。用戶在應(yīng)用軟件的過程中可以通過云計算機系統(tǒng)對其進行統(tǒng)一的部署;同時,在云計算環(huán)境之下,能夠及時發(fā)現(xiàn)并屏蔽個人計算機出現(xiàn)的故障和問題,把對其他在線用戶的影響降到最低,甚至能夠做到毫無影響。
3 高校機房管理功能的發(fā)展
在傳統(tǒng)的高校機房管理過程中,都是通過傳統(tǒng)的手工登錄方式對其進行管理,此種管理方式較為滯后,存在著一定的問題與不足,對此在實踐中要想提升管理的效率與質(zhì)量,實現(xiàn)開放式機房,就必須要通過集約管理系統(tǒng)(Computer lab intensive management system)對其進行系統(tǒng)的管理。集約化管理系統(tǒng)就是為解決開放式公共機房在管理中存在的問題、提高工作效率、完善管理制度,我們設(shè)計開發(fā)了機房的集約化管理系統(tǒng)(CLIMS)(見圖1)。涵蓋上機人員的信息采集、機房計算機統(tǒng)一管理(如開啟-關(guān)閉)及點對點分控管理、人員登錄、機位確定(自動或指定)、數(shù)據(jù)匯總、統(tǒng)計輸出等一系列前后臺管理及統(tǒng)計功能。
3.1 高校機房管理功能
(1)系統(tǒng)的賬號認(rèn)證。對學(xué)生的上機賬號、密碼通過計算機中心對其進行統(tǒng)一的分配,在進行上機操作過程中,要輸入正確的上機賬號與密碼,然后在通過服務(wù)器驗證之后進行上機操作;在高校開展各種對外活動的狀況下,可以通過開放式的模式,在無需用戶賬號與密碼的狀況之下也可以進行登陸。
(2)學(xué)生在下課關(guān)機后,可以通過管理系統(tǒng)對設(shè)定的繳費屬性使用人自動進行計算費用,反饋信息至CLIM進行統(tǒng)計并且發(fā)出提示;
(3)可以通過系統(tǒng)對其進行設(shè)置不同的上課時間與具體的開放時間,再通過系統(tǒng)對其進行自動的切換執(zhí)行操作;
(4)做好上機日志記錄,為工作人員的查詢以及統(tǒng)計提供參考。
3.2 CLIMS系統(tǒng)設(shè)計的關(guān)鍵問題
在對機房管理系統(tǒng)設(shè)計進行設(shè)計的過程中,要基于機房的實際狀況開展,要提升對以下幾點的重視:
3.2.1 網(wǎng)絡(luò)信息的穩(wěn)定性
計算機在使用的過程中,勢必會出現(xiàn)一定的時延問題,這種問題很容易導(dǎo)致信息以及數(shù)據(jù)的丟失問題,這無疑給網(wǎng)絡(luò)運行的安全性、穩(wěn)定性以及速度產(chǎn)生一定的影響,因為機房管理系統(tǒng)中應(yīng)用了互聯(lián)網(wǎng)絡(luò)以及云計算等遠(yuǎn)程的管理功能,對此在實踐中必須要強化信息傳遞系統(tǒng)速度的重視,保障其整體的安全性。
3.2.2 數(shù)據(jù)庫設(shè)計
數(shù)據(jù)庫作為整個信息保存的關(guān)鍵場所,在實踐中其設(shè)計的合理性直接關(guān)系到系統(tǒng)運行以及數(shù)據(jù)信息的安全性,也直接的影響到整個數(shù)據(jù)信息的訪問速度與效率。對此在實踐中進行數(shù)據(jù)庫信息的設(shè)計過程中必須要保障數(shù)據(jù)信息的一致性;保障其具有一定的冗余性,進而減少查詢動作,提升數(shù)據(jù)信息的完整性,提升系統(tǒng)的快速反應(yīng);合理的選擇數(shù)據(jù)的信息類型,減少其整體的存儲空間;提升運算的效率;實現(xiàn)其遠(yuǎn)程操作的同步化,進而在根本上保障各項數(shù)據(jù)信息的正常合理應(yīng)用。
3.2.3 系統(tǒng)反應(yīng)速度
系統(tǒng)的反應(yīng)速度主要就是學(xué)生的登陸速度、瀏覽的網(wǎng)頁速度、信息的實際傳輸速度、服務(wù)器中相關(guān)信息的實際反應(yīng)速度等內(nèi)容。系統(tǒng)反應(yīng)速度直接影響其整體的學(xué)習(xí)效率與質(zhì)量。
3.3 服務(wù)器端的設(shè)計
服務(wù)器端就是要滿足系統(tǒng)運行的實際需求,要對客戶端進行系統(tǒng)的判斷,在對數(shù)據(jù)庫的服務(wù)器進行訪問之后,反饋相關(guān)信息結(jié)果到客戶端中,其主要的設(shè)計功能主要如下:
3.3.1 服務(wù)器教師端的設(shè)計
設(shè)備管理模塊,就是可以要提供一些對設(shè)備信息的添加才操作、修改操作、綜合查詢、設(shè)備維護管理操作以及統(tǒng)計與查詢、設(shè)備報廢管理以及各項信息的查詢以及清理等相關(guān)功能。
實驗教學(xué)管理模塊,就是為課程信息、實驗項目信息等相關(guān)內(nèi)容的添加操作、修改操作、刪除操作、查詢與打印操作以及相關(guān)信息的統(tǒng)計等操作。
報表管理模塊,主要就是設(shè)備中各種信息報表、實驗教學(xué)報表信息的管理,為客戶的查詢以及打印提供幫助。
系統(tǒng)設(shè)置模塊,此模塊只有通過系統(tǒng)管理員才可以應(yīng)用,涵蓋了管理員的設(shè)置、數(shù)據(jù)庫清空管理、數(shù)據(jù)庫信息的遠(yuǎn)程備份等相關(guān)操作內(nèi)容,而管理員設(shè)置主要涵蓋了普通用戶的權(quán)限設(shè)置、普通用戶以及相關(guān)系統(tǒng)用戶的信息添加以及刪除等操作;數(shù)據(jù)庫清理就是在實踐中及時清理各種過期的信息內(nèi)容,而數(shù)據(jù)庫遠(yuǎn)程備份的主要目的就是為了提升信息數(shù)據(jù)庫的安全性,在客戶端備份的一種方式。
用戶設(shè)置,為用戶信息的構(gòu)建、修改以及各種信息密碼的更換、轉(zhuǎn)換用戶信息角色、刪除用戶等相關(guān)功能。
數(shù)據(jù)庫操作模塊,可以真正的實現(xiàn)服務(wù)器端口配置系統(tǒng)的數(shù)據(jù)庫信息、數(shù)據(jù)庫備份以及數(shù)據(jù)庫信息恢復(fù)等相關(guān)功能。
客戶端監(jiān)控,可以通過遠(yuǎn)程監(jiān)控的方式對客戶端的運行狀況進行系統(tǒng)的了解,監(jiān)控客戶端的實際鏈接狀況,進而及時查看具體的應(yīng)用時間、具體的費用以及相關(guān)賬戶信息余額等相關(guān)內(nèi)容。
管理員登錄模塊,設(shè)置了兩種模式的管理員賬戶的登錄以及注銷。
幫助模塊,用戶在操作過程中遇到各種問題可以通過幫主模塊對其進行信息的查詢,進而解決問題。
3.3.2 客戶機學(xué)生端(門禁端)的設(shè)計
高校計算機機房管理系統(tǒng)的客戶機學(xué)生端是一個相對較為獨立運行的系統(tǒng)模式,考慮開放式機房的管理特點,在實踐中采用一機管理模式,其主要設(shè)計如下:
在教師機上采用“登錄—管理”的一機化(亦可在機房進門端設(shè)置一臺微機作為客戶機),實現(xiàn)上機用戶集中登錄、下機自動注銷。學(xué)生在客戶端的操作過程中通過刷卡、手工錄入或面部識別等方式登陸,系統(tǒng)自動指定使用者的上機機位,應(yīng)用計算機開展信息的查詢與操作,進而完成上機情況統(tǒng)計或費用的結(jié)算。
上機情況統(tǒng)計、費用查詢以及監(jiān)控模塊,學(xué)生在實踐中通過信息查詢功能,就可以對自己的上機時間、費用等相關(guān)狀況進行查詢,整個監(jiān)控模塊具有透明性的特征,主要就是通過服務(wù)器端對客戶端進行控制。
4 原程序編譯片段
CLIM部分原程序如下:
namespace 實驗室計算機監(jiān)控系統(tǒng)
{
publicpartialclassForm_實驗室計算機監(jiān)控系統(tǒng) : Form
{
publicstaticSDND_系統(tǒng)公用定義Class SDND_Common = newSDND_系統(tǒng)公用定義Class();
publicList<網(wǎng)絡(luò)設(shè)備Type> 當(dāng)前系統(tǒng)設(shè)備;
public Form_實驗室計算機監(jiān)控系統(tǒng)()
{
InitializeComponent();
SDND_Common.Init系統(tǒng)變量();
SDND_Common.InitSystemWorkground();
SDND_Common.GetCurrentSystemWorkground();
SDND_Common.ReadAndWrite賬戶信息("Read", ref SDND_Common.賬戶信息);
}
privatevoid Form_實驗室計算機監(jiān)控系統(tǒng)_Load(object sender, EventArgs e)
{
this.Text = Form_實驗室計算機監(jiān)控系統(tǒng).SDND_Common.設(shè)備標(biāo)題 +
"【" + Form_實驗室計算機監(jiān)控系統(tǒng).SDND_Common.操作員.人員.姓名 + "" +
DateTime.Now.ToLongDateString() + "" + DateTime.Now.ToLongTimeString() + "】";
SetWorkWindowsEnabled(true);
CloseActiveWindows(null);
InitmenuStrip_菜單(false);
SDND_Common.Init當(dāng)前系統(tǒng)設(shè)備(ref 當(dāng)前系統(tǒng)設(shè)備);
Form_設(shè)備管理.Init控制設(shè)備(當(dāng)前系統(tǒng)設(shè)備);
Form_設(shè)備控制.Init控制設(shè)備(當(dāng)前系統(tǒng)設(shè)備);
}
……(省略)
5 結(jié)束語
高校機房的集約化管理是構(gòu)建開放式機房的重要方式與手段,也是今后高校計算機管理的重要內(nèi)容,對此在實踐中,必須要基于高校機房的實際管理意義,綜合實際狀況,不斷地完善優(yōu)化集約化管理的實踐工作,對其進行系統(tǒng)的開發(fā)與設(shè)計,進而在根本上提升高校教學(xué)的整體質(zhì)量與效果。
參考文獻
[1]王眾.基于RFID技術(shù)的高校機房管理系統(tǒng)設(shè)計與實現(xiàn)[D].江西財經(jīng)大學(xué),2016.
[2]谷豐.機房管理系統(tǒng)的設(shè)計與實現(xiàn)[D].華南理工大學(xué),2015.
[3]劉海萍.高校計算機機房管理系統(tǒng)的設(shè)計與實現(xiàn)[D].華南理工大學(xué),2013.
作者簡介
李力強(1960-),男,山東省泰安市人。實驗師,大學(xué)本科學(xué)歷。研究方向為計算機應(yīng)用。
作者單位
山東農(nóng)業(yè)大學(xué)信息學(xué)院 山東省泰安市 271018